Aamir Khan, who has been delivering a series of underperforming films for years now, has gone on to reveal that he never wanted to be a producer. The actor's latest offering is Sitaare Zameen Par, which faced controversy even after it started streaming digitally. The actor got candid about his shift from acting to production when speaking during a recent podcast. Aamir is now producing Sunny Deol's Lahore 1947, which was also in the midst of controversy recently. Here's everything you need to know...

Aamir Khan's statement

While talking to Komal Nahta on Game Changers, Aamir Khan revealed that he never wanted to be a producer and realized it early on. "Mujhe lagta hai jab maine apne father ka career dekha first-hand, toh mujhe realize hua mujhe producer kabhi nahi banna hai," the actor said, stating that it was mainly because a producer invests, takes a huge risk and faces all the backlash also. He also added how there are times when the team doesn't co-operate with the producer's budget. The actor recalled how during Qayamat Se Qayamat Tak, he felt like he was a successful actor and thus, there was no need to be a producer, especially because he is satisfied with his work and his producers were happy, too. However, things changed along the way, and now, Aamir is both a producer as well as an actor.

Aamir Khan's underperforming films over the years

Aamir Khan has served underperforming films over the past few years. It began with Thugs of Hindostan, and the actor was then seen in Forrest Gump remake Laal Singh Chaddha. Both the movies turned out to be Box Office disasters. Aamir's latest release Sitaare Zameen Par, despite performing better than the first two films, was still underwhelming for the superstar who once delivered Rs. 200 crore films within the first weekend itself.

The backlash for Sitaare Zameen Par's digital streaming

With Sitaare Zameen Par, Aamir Khan introduced a pay-per-view model on his YouTube channel. This model did not sit well with the OTT consuming audiences who found it an expensive affair. Thus, many refused to watch the movie digitally. Not just Sitaare Zameen Par, Aamir has also started streaming movies produced by him on the YouTube channel owned by his production company. The movies were once a part of OTT platforms, but were shifted as part of Aamir's plan.
